Class JDatabaseQueryMysqli
Query Building Class.
- JDatabaseQuery
- JDatabaseQueryMysqli implements JDatabaseQueryLimitable
Direct known subclasses
Copyright: Copyright (C) 2005 - 2017 Open Source Matters, Inc. All rights reserved.
License: General Public License version 2 or later; see LICENSE
Since: 11.1
Located at joomla/database/query/mysqli.php
Methods summary
public
string
|
|
public
string
|
#
processLimit( string $query, integer $limit, integer $offset = 0 )
Method to modify a query already in string format with the needed additions to make the query limited to a particular number of results, or start at a particular offset. |
public
string
|
#
concatenate( array $values, string $separator = null )
Concatenates an array of column names or values. |
public
|
|
public
string
|
|
public
string
|
|
public
|
#
selectRowNumber( string $orderBy, string $orderColumnAlias )
Return the number of the current row. |
public
string
|
Methods inherited from JDatabaseQuery
__call()
,
__clone()
,
__construct()
,
__get()
,
andWhere()
,
call()
,
charLength()
,
clear()
,
columns()
,
currentTimestamp()
,
dateAdd()
,
dateFormat()
,
day()
,
delete()
,
dump()
,
escape()
,
exec()
,
extendWhere()
,
format()
,
from()
,
group()
,
having()
,
hour()
,
innerJoin()
,
insert()
,
join()
,
leftJoin()
,
length()
,
minute()
,
month()
,
nullDate()
,
orWhere()
,
order()
,
outerJoin()
,
quote()
,
quoteName()
,
rightJoin()
,
second()
,
select()
,
set()
,
setQuery()
,
union()
,
unionAll()
,
unionDistinct()
,
update()
,
validateRowNumber()
,
values()
,
where()
,
year()
Magic methods summary
Magic methods inherited from JDatabaseQuery
Properties summary
protected
integer
|
$offset |
#
The offset for the result set. |
protected
integer
|
$limit |
#
The limit for the result set. |
Properties inherited from JDatabaseQuery
$autoIncrementField
,
$call
,
$columns
,
$db
,
$delete
,
$element
,
$exec
,
$from
,
$group
,
$having
,
$insert
,
$join
,
$order
,
$select
,
$selectRowNumber
,
$set
,
$sql
,
$type
,
$union
,
$unionAll
,
$update
,
$values
,
$where